Applications are sought for a Post-doctoral Research Fellow to work with Professor Tom Rice conducting research for an AHRC-DFG funded project entitled “Relocating Filmstrips, Remapping Europe”. 

 

The successful applicant will work as part of a collaborative European project team, alongside the two PIs (Professor Tom Rice, University of St Andrews and Professor Vinzenz Hediger, Goethe University, Frankfurt), a Post-doctoral Research Fellow at Goethe University Frankfurt (30 months) and institutional partners in the UK and Germany.

 

The primary duties will include: researching, and mapping, filmstrip materials in UK-based archives; producing scholarship (including conference presentations, a peer-reviewed article and book chapter); and co-organising project events and collaborative, public-facing initiatives (including a conference, workshop and virtual exhibition).

 

The successful applicant will have (or be near to completion of) a PhD in Film/Media Studies or a related discipline.

 

This is a full-time post working 36.25 hours per week available on a fixed term contract for 30 months, starting 1 May 2025 or as soon as possible thereafter.
